Understanding the WNBA Playoff Format

The WNBA playoff format is crucial to understanding how the schedule unfolds. Currently, the top eight teams in the league, regardless of conference, qualify for the playoffs. This setup ensures that the most competitive teams have a shot at the title. Once the eight teams are set, they are seeded based on their regular-season record. The higher the seed, the better the advantage, particularly in the earlier rounds. The first round consists of a best-of-three series, where the higher seed hosts the first two games, and the lower seed hosts the third game, if necessary. This format adds an extra layer of intensity and strategy to the initial matchups. Winning the first round is crucial, as it sets the tone for the rest of the playoffs. The subsequent rounds, the semifinals and the finals, follow a best-of-five format, further escalating the competition. Key Dates and Timeline

To fully engage with the WNBA playoffs, it's essential to mark your calendar with the key dates and timeline. The WNBA playoff schedule typically kicks off in late August or early September, following the conclusion of the regular season. The exact dates can vary slightly each year, so it's always a good idea to check the official WNBA website or reliable sports news outlets for the most up-to-date information. The first round, with its best-of-three series, usually spans about a week, providing a quick burst of intense matchups. Following the first round, the semifinals begin, and these best-of-five series extend over a week and a half, building the anticipation as teams get closer to the finals. The WNBA Finals, the pinnacle of the season, are also a best-of-five series and typically occur in late September or early October. These games are spread out to maximize viewership and excitement. How the Playoff Schedule Impacts Team Strategy

The playoff schedule significantly impacts team strategy in the WNBA. The format, with its best-of-three and best-of-five series, requires teams to plan meticulously and adjust their approach as needed. The schedule influences everything from player rotations and rest periods to scouting reports and game-day tactics. In the early rounds, the quick turnaround between games means that teams must be prepared to make adjustments on the fly. The higher seeds, with home-court advantage in the first two games, have an opportunity to set the tone for the series. However, the lower seeds can use the third game at home to their advantage, especially if they can steal a win on the road. As the playoffs progress, the best-of-five series allow for more in-depth strategic adjustments. Coaches have more time to analyze film, identify weaknesses, and make changes to their game plan. Player fatigue becomes a factor, so teams with deep benches and versatile lineups have an advantage. The playoff schedule also impacts the psychological aspect of the game.
